Understanding Cultural Nuances

As a foreigner, it’s critical to know Thai gender roles and dating taboos.
- It’s common for men to pay for the first date and take the lead in the relationship.
- Public displays of affection are not standard in Thai culture, so it’s essential to be respectful and avoid making your date uncomfortable.
Cross-cultural dating challenges may also arise, so it’s vital to approach dating with an open mind and willingness to learn. Here are some cultural nuances to keep in mind:
- Traditional Thai values may clash with Western values, such as the importance of independence and individualism.
- Religion plays a significant role in Thai culture, so respecting Buddhist customs and beliefs is crucial.
- Communication styles may differ, with Thai people tending to be indirect and avoiding conflict.
Despite these challenges, embracing and understanding these cultural nuances can lead to a more fulfilling and successful dating experience in Bangkok.

Mastering the Art of Approach

To truly excel at approaching potential partners in Bangkok, you’ll need to dig deeper than just relying on standard pickup lines and techniques – try to uncover what makes the culture and people of this city unique and incorporate that knowledge into your approach.
Approaching confidently is critical, but being aware of cultural nuances and expectations is essential.
Thai people value politeness and respect, so make sure to greet your potential partner with a wai (a traditional Thai greeting) and use appropriate titles such as khun (Mr./Mrs.) or nong (little brother/sister), depending on their age and social status.
Body language also plays a crucial role in approaching potential partners in Bangkok.
Remember to maintain eye contact, smile, and use open body language to show you’re approachable and friendly.
Breaking the ice with humor can also be effective – Thai people love to laugh and appreciate a good sense of humor.
A playful joke or lighthearted comment can help ease tension and create a more relaxed and enjoyable atmosphere.

Ensuring Safety in Offline Dating
When meeting potential partners offline in Thailand, ensuring safety is paramount – here are some tips and strategies to keep in mind.
- First and foremost, always meet in a public place. This could be a coffee shop, a restaurant, or a park. Do not agree to meet someone privately until you have established trust and feel comfortable with them.
- Always let a friend or family member know where you will be and whom you will meet. Having someone who can check in on you and ensure your safety is essential.
- Trust your instincts. If something feels off or uncomfortable, it’s okay to end the date early and leave.
Common safety concerns in Bangkok dating include scams and theft. Be cautious of individuals who ask for money or try to pressure you into giving them personal information.
- Constantly monitor your belongings, especially in crowded areas like markets or public transportation.
- It’s also important to set boundaries in offline dating. Communicate your limits clearly and be firm in enforcing them.
